Ingredients
Scale
- 10 oz. box frozen chopped spinach (thawed and squeezed)
- 8 oz. mushrooms
- 1 garlic clove (minced)
- ⅛ tsp salt
- 1 tbsp cooking oil (divided)
- 2 oz. feta cheese
- 4 large eggs
- ¼ cup parmesan cheese (grated)
- ¼ tsp black pepper (freshly cracked)
- 1 cup milk
- ½ cup mozzarella cheese (shredded)
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350ºF. Prepare the spinach by thawing and squeezing out excess moisture.
- Clean the mushrooms, then slice them thinly. Mince the garlic.
- In a skillet, combine the mushrooms, garlic, salt, and ½ tablespoon of cooking oil. Sauté over medium heat until the mushrooms are tender and all moisture has evaporated.
- Grease a 9-inch pie plate with the remaining ½ tablespoon of cooking oil. Layer the mushrooms, spinach, and crumbled feta cheese in the pie plate.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together the eggs, Parmesan cheese, black pepper, and milk until combined.
- Pour the egg mixture over the layered vegetables and cheese in the pie plate. Top with shredded mozzarella cheese.
- Bake in the preheated oven for about 50 minutes, or until golden brown on top and the internal temperature reaches 160ºF. Slice and serve!
Notes
Make sure to squeeze out as much water as possible from the spinach to keep the quiche from becoming soggy.
Feel free to customize the vegetables according to your preferences or seasonal availability.
This quiche can be enjoyed warm or cold, making it great for meal prep.
